✨ What Is Emsella?
BTL Emsella is a revolutionary chair that uses HIFEM® (High-Intensity Focused Electromagnetic) technology to deliver the equivalent of 12,000+ pelvic-floor contractions in a single 28-minute session. It targets the exact muscles responsible for bladder control, core support, and intimate wellness.

🧠 Meet BTL ExoMind: A Breakthrough in Mental Wellness
BTL ExoMind is a cutting-edge, non-invasive brain stimulation treatment designed for mental and emotional well-being. Powered by ExoTMS™ technology, it offers a natural, drug-free way to support mood, focus, sleep, and resilience. 
⸻
💡 How ExoMind Works
• The device uses magnetic pulses to target the dorsolateral prefrontal cortex (DLPFC), a brain region deeply involved in emotional regulation, decision-making, and executive function. 
• These pulses help activate neuroplasticity—strengthening neural pathways and improving communication between key brain regions. 
• Over a series of sessions, this rewiring supports better mood control, sharper cognitive function, and greater emotional stability.

1. FDA-Cleared & Global Approvals
ExoMind is FDA-cleared for major depressive disorder in the U.S., and also has Health Canada approval and CE marking for use in conditions like anxiety, OCD, and binge eating.
